Nick Diaz recently met Sean Strickland, and they shared a full-circle moment during their first-ever meeting at a gym.
What happened?
Strickland admitted to watching Nick Diaz as a kid, saying "When I was a kid, I used to watch you, bro. I’d be in my f*cking boxer shorts in the living room, watching you scrap."
Diaz replied, "Now I watch you," showing honest admiration.

What comes next?
Nick Diaz has begun MMA training once again, with Jake Shields posting a video of him sparring at 42 years old.
Cesar Gracie updated on March 26, 2025, that Diaz was healthy and doing well after withdrawing from a UFC 310 bout with Vicente Luque on December 7, 2024.
Diaz got married in Las Vegas last week to his long-time girlfriend Kayla and has just celebrated 1 year of sobriety.
He recently got out of rehab and is in good spirits with his new wife.
Diaz's record shows a long career with legendary moments, but recent years have been defined more by personal struggles than fighting accomplishments.
